I went and looked at this teener in Anitoch this afternoon and for anyone who saw the ad and wanted more info here you go!

Green 914 on Craigslist for $2000

The Bad:
1. Both front fenders rusted out
2. Ground visible through the hell hole!
3. Jack point on passenger side rusted out
4. Rust showing through on rear of driver side sill
5. Front bumper smashed
6. New heavy coat of metalic green paint and bondo to cover the bad spots

The Good:
1. 1.8 engine runs and tail shift trans shifts
2. Interior in fair condition
3. all parts are there and most seem usable

He told me first that he paid $2000 for it and when I talked to him in person he said he paid $300 so I offered him a few hundred more (IMG:style_emoticons/default/sawzall-smiley.gif) and he said no!

He is a nice guy but he doesn't know anything about these cars.
